Welcome to Fredd "Glossie" Atkins Park in Sarasota, Florida, a suburb of Tampa. This park is named for the first African American to be elected both City Commissioner and Mayor of Sarasota. Perhaps the park's most unique feature is the Dedication Wall dedicated to many "first African Americans" to hold certain offices and jobs in the region.

Sarasota Florida Park Ordinances
*Unless otherwise posted all parks open at 5:00 a.m. and close at 11:00 p.m.
*The following are prohibited; defacing public property, littering.
*The following are only allowed in designated areas; fires, golfing, motor vehicles.
*The following require special permits; archery, flying remote control aircraft, planting.
*All dogs must be leashed and waste removed.
Please respect these and all local, State of Florida, and United States statutes.
